
This package helps game devs build novel AI game systems and mechanics around small language models that run locally on CPU.Aviad AI for Unity is a free package that helps you build novel AI game systems and mechanics around small language models that run locally on CPU.🛠️ FeaturesSLM-powered dialogue system that works out of the box and can be deeply customized.Embedding models for interpretation tasks and dynamic mechanics like dynamic animation selection.Open-source sample games and scenes with example mechanics for dynamic dialogue, NPC choices, dynamic animation, etc.Free, open-source Aviad models on our HuggingFace account. They're finetuned for specific tasks, try them out and let us know what you think. If you'd like custom models trained for your game, please reach out!Models run comfortably on CPU and low-end consumer devices.WebGL, Windows, MacOS platform support.🚀 Getting startedWe've outlined how to get started here. Check out our sample games for example implementations of different AI game mechanics.🎮 Who we areWe're a small team at Aviad motivated to help game devs create entirely new games that aren’t possible without AI. We believe small language models are a promising new game asset that can power more immersive and dynamic game systems.👋 Reach outJoin us on Discord! We're active there and can answer questions, fix bugs, and prioritize feature/model requests.Drop us a note at hello@aviad.aiSchedule a call with us. We're working with several studios on more complicated game systems and are always looking to work with more.Supports Windows, MacOS, WebGL.Runs on CPU.